On Fri, 2015-03-13 at 17:46 +0000, Justin Musgrove wrote:
My apologizes for my ignorance with using an incorrect method. Is there
a method in evolution to prompt a different "reply" methods in lieu of
the global option?
The default settings for replying and forwarding can be changed under
"Edit ▸ Preferences ▸ Composer Preferences ▸ General ▸ Replies and
Forwards ▸ Reply style".
(from
https://help.gnome.org/users/evolution/stable/mail-composer-reply.html )
I think the OP may have been asking if there is a way to do this
differently according to the kind of message. That could be a useful
option, e.g. when replying to a list versus a non-list message.
